codeblocks调试
时间: 2023-12-09 15:05:13 浏览: 44
在CodeBlocks中进行调试的主要目的是跟踪变量值,观察程序是否按预期执行,并定位和解决BUG。在调试之前,您需要考虑可能存在问题的代码段,并在该代码段之后设置断点。下面是在CodeBlocks中进行调试的步骤:
1. 打开CodeBlocks并加载您的项目。
2. 选择要调试的源文件,并在代码的适当位置设置断点。断点是您希望程序在该处停止执行的标记。
3. 单击菜单栏上的“调试”按钮,或按下F8键开始调试。
4. 在调试模式下,程序将逐行执行代码直到遇到您设置的断点。一旦程序停止在断点处,您可以观察变量的值,检查程序状态,并分析问题所在。
5. 使用调试器提供的功能,如单步执行、逐过程调试、查看变量的值和内存内容等来辅助您的调试工作。
6. 如果发现了问题,您可以修改代码并继续调试,直到问题被解决。
7. 当调试完成时,可以选择终止调试或继续执行程序。
请注意,以上是CodeBlocks中进行调试的一般步骤。具体操作可能会因个人习惯和项目的需求而有所不同。希望这些信息对您有帮助。
相关问题
codeblocks调试程序
CodeBlocks是一个免费开源的软件,支持C和C++开发,并且也提供了程序的单步调试功能。要使用CodeBlocks进行程序的调试,您可以按照以下步骤进行操作:
1. 首先,在CodeBlocks中打开您的项目或者创建一个新项目。
2. 然后,在菜单栏中选择"Settings",然后选择"Debugger"。
3. 在调试器设置中,您可以配置调试按键和变量窗口的显示方式。
4. 接下来,您可以在代码中设置断点。在您希望程序暂停执行的位置,单击行号区域即可设置断点。
5. 当您运行程序时,程序会在遇到断点时暂停执行。此时,您可以通过观察变量窗口中的变量值、调用堆栈等来分析程序的执行情况。
6. 您可以使用调试按键,如继续执行、单步执行、跳过当前函数等,来逐步执行程序并观察其运行过程。
7. 如果遇到问题,您可以使用调试器提供的功能来定位问题的所在,例如查看变量值、调用堆栈等。
8. 调试完成后,您可以在菜单栏中选择"Stop Debugging"或者关闭调试器来停止调试过程。
总结一下,要使用CodeBlocks进行程序的调试,您需要设置断点、观察变量值和调用堆栈,并使用调试按键逐步执行程序并定位问题的所在。希望这些信息对您有所帮助!
codeblocks调试器
CodeBlocks是一个集成开发环境(IDE),它提供了调试功能,可以帮助开发人员在程序中查找和解决错误。在CodeBlocks中,调试器可以帮助你定位和修复代码中的错误。通过设置调试器路径和使用调试工具,你可以在CodeBlocks中启动和运行调试会话,在代码中设置断点,逐步执行代码,并观察变量的值以及程序的执行流程。调试器还可以提供一些额外的功能,例如查看内存,监视变量和表达式的值,以及跟踪函数的调用。总之,CodeBlocks的调试器是一个非常有用的工具,可以帮助你更有效地调试和优化你的代码。